About

Rattlesnake Group Campground was a group camping facility located on Bartlett Lake within Arizona's Tonto National Forest. The campground has been permanently decommissioned and no longer accepts overnight camping. The site now operates as Rattlesnake Cove Picnic Site, a day-use only facility open from 6:00 a.m. to 10:00 p.m. The picnic area offers 41 ramadas equipped with picnic tables and grills, vault toilets, and staircase access to the Bartlett Lake shoreline. No potable water is available on-site. Campers seeking group camping options in the Tonto National Forest should explore other facilities in the Cave Creek Ranger District or nearby areas around Bartlett Lake.

Directions

From Carefree, take Cave Creek Road 7 miles, turn right on Bartlett Dam Road and continue for 13 miles, then turn left on FR 459. Travel half a mile on FR 459 and turn right into the site.
